Arelio

Meaning of Arelio

The name Arelio, a distinctive and melodious choice for a boy, has roots deeply embedded in Spanish and Italian cultures. Pronounced as ahr-AY-lee-oh in Spanish and ah-REH-lee-o in Italian, Arelio is often considered a variant of the name Aurelio, which derives from the Latin "Aurelius," meaning "golden" or "gilded." This historical and noble association imbues the name with a sense of classical elegance and enduring value. Although not very common in the United States, with only 5 newborns named Arelio in 2023 ranking it at 12,190th, its rarity can make it an appealing option for parents seeking a unique yet culturally rich name for their son.
